Core Viewpoint - Changchun High-tech has submitted an application for overseas listing (H shares) on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ange, following a significant decline in its stock price, which has dropped over 70% since 2021 due to price reductions in its core product, growth hormone, resulting in a projected decline in revenue and net profit for 2024 and the first half of 2025 [2][10]. Financial Performance - In 2024, Changchun High-tech's revenue is expected to be 13.466 billion yuan, a year-on-year decrease of 7.55%, while net profit is projected at 2.583 billion yuan, down 43.01% [4]. - For the first half of 2025, the company anticipates revenue of 6.603 billion yuan, a slight decline of 0.54%, and a net profit of 983 million yuan, down 42.85% [4]. - The gross profit margin from drug sales has decreased from 91.6% in 2022 to 88.6% in the first half of 2025 [6]. Core Business Impact - The main revenue and profit contributions come from the growth hormone business of Jinsai Pharmaceutical, which saw a revenue of 10.671 billion yuan in 2024, down 3.73%, and a net profit of 2.678 billion yuan, down 40.67% [10]. - In the first half of 2025, Jinsai Pharmaceutical's revenue was 5.469 billion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 6.17%, but net profit decreased by 37.35% to 1.108 billion yuan [10]. - The vaccine business of Baike Biotechnology also faced challenges, with revenue dropping to 1.229 billion yuan in 2024, down 32.64%, and a net profit of 232 million yuan, down 53.67% [11]. Market Challenges - The growth hormone product has been included in centralized procurement in several provinces since 2022, leading to significant price reductions and increased competition from similar products [10]. - The company's international revenue remains low, with only 130 million yuan in 2024, accounting for 0.97% of total revenue, and 1.13% in the first half of 2025 [12].

Core Viewpoint - China Pacific Insurance (CPIC) is taking significant steps to enhance its international presence and address capital structure pressures through the issuance of zero-coupon convertible bonds in Hong Kong, following a similar move by Ping An [5][10][15]. Financing Strategy - CPIC announced the issuance of HKD 15.6 billion in zero-coupon convertible bonds, maturing in 2030, which can be converted into H-shares [5]. - The funds raised will primarily support the insurance core business and the implementation of three strategic initiatives: "Great Health," "AI+," and internationalization [6]. - The issuance of convertible bonds is seen as a strategic move to supplement capital and accelerate internationalization, especially as CPIC's net assets have decreased by 3.3% since the beginning of the year [6][12]. Industry Context - The issuance of convertible bonds has become a common practice among large insurance companies, balancing the need for continuous dividends with increasing solvency pressures [7]. - CPIC is the second mainland insurance company to utilize this financing method in Hong Kong, following Ping An's USD 3.5 billion issuance last year, indicating a potential trend in the industry [8][17]. Internationalization Efforts - CPIC has lagged behind peers like Ping An and China Life in international expansion, with a total QDII quota of USD 2.627 billion, slightly above Xinhua's USD 2.4 billion, despite having a larger asset base [12]. - Recent initiatives include the approval of a tokenized USD money market fund and the launch of electric vehicle insurance in Thailand, marking a significant acceleration in overseas business development [14]. Regulatory Environment - The issuance of USD convertible bonds allows CPIC to maintain a lower dilution pressure on equity and create a funding pool for overseas operations without the complexities of capital repatriation [15]. - The current regulatory framework provides flexibility for funds raised through convertible bonds to remain offshore, reducing friction costs associated with cross-border capital flows [16]. Future Implications - The trend of using convertible bonds for financing may lead to more insurance companies following suit, prompting regulatory scrutiny regarding capital management and fund usage [17]. - The potential for increased participation from other insurers could transform this financing method from an isolated innovation into a collective industry trend [17].

Core Viewpoint - The article highlights the significant achievements of YTO Express during the "14th Five-Year Plan" period, emphasizing its commitment to deepening its core express business while advancing digitalization, intelligence, and internationalization strategies [1][6]. Digital Transformation - YTO Express is undergoing a digital and intelligent transformation, enhancing its core AI capabilities and integrating artificial intelligence into business scenarios to improve efficiency and reduce costs [2][3]. - The company has implemented an intelligent scheduling system to optimize transportation efficiency, resulting in a 26% reduction in per-package transportation costs, which decreased from 0.50 yuan in 2021 to 0.37 yuan in the first half of 2023 [2]. End-Delivery and Customer Service Innovations - The introduction of the "AI Assistant for Couriers" aims to save each courier 30 to 60 minutes daily by optimizing delivery routes and utilizing voice and image recognition technologies [3]. - YTO Express has upgraded its customer service processes, achieving a 16% year-on-year reduction in repeat call rates by enhancing AI-driven claims processing and customer management systems [3]. International Expansion - YTO Express has accelerated its international development, launching a new processing center in Melbourne and establishing a partnership with Xiaomi for cross-border supply chain services [4]. - The company has opened over 150 cargo routes and operates a fleet of 13 aircraft, enhancing its global logistics capabilities and service offerings [4]. High-Quality Development Focus - YTO Express's express business volume is projected to grow from 16.543 billion packages in 2021 to 26.573 billion packages in 2024, with revenue increasing from 45.155 billion yuan to 69.033 billion yuan in the same period [6]. - The company aims to improve operational efficiency and service quality while enhancing brand value through a focus on quality, technology, and sustainability [7].
